If every track on the Hugh Masekela’s umpteenth album sounds like a jubilant celebration at the end of a long struggle or significant event, you’re not making movie montages out of molehills. Jabulani is an homage to the wedding traditions the 72-year-old trumpeter grew up participating in in South Africa. Accompanied by a full band, a small choir and plenty of gospel and soul twinges, Masekela’s gravelly tenor and bright trumpet blast the dizzying joy and the deep sense of community a wedding can encompass into the layered party of “Tsoang Tsoang” and the lilting, conversational “Fiela.”
- Rachel Devitt
